Q: Is 211,402,404 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 211,402,404 is not a prime number.

Why is 211,402,404 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 211402404 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 9 12 18 36 5,872,289 11,744,578 17,616,867 23,489,156 35,233,734 52,850,601 70,467,468 105,701,202 and 211,402,404, with no remainder.

Since 211,402,404 cannot be divided by just 1 and 211,402,404, it is not a prime number.
